			Well after seeing Freddy build his Ford I just had to buckle down and start on mine. I of course started the same way with a bone stock push toy that was new and started butching from there. I've put a couple of evening into it so far and have several more to come to get it going but here are a few pics of my start.  
		
		
		
		
		
		
			![]() ![]() Crawler transmission installed. Hopefully this will have enough torque in the gearing along with the 9 tooth pinion to pull this hog. ![]() Steering knuckle made up and mounted. ![]() ![]() Bottom view. All the screws will be tapered and flush mount and stainless when they come in from McMaster this week. ![]() My version to get as much axle and driveshaft clearance resulted in machining a custom joint to clear the servo flush under the arm and still twist under the axle. ![]() Thats all for the moment but I hope to have more progress pics of this up soon.
